Street Lights: Illuminating the Night and Enhancing Safety

Introduction to Street Lights Street lights, often referred to as "Street Lights," are an integral part of urban infrastructure, providing illumination to the streets and pathways during the night. These fixtures are designed to enhance safety, guide pedestrians, and facilitate traffic flow. With the advancements in technology, street lights have evolved from simple light bulbs to smart and energy-efficient systems. This article delves into the history, types, benefits, and future trends of street lights.

History of Street Lights The history of street lighting dates back to ancient times when people used various methods to illuminate the streets. In the 19th century, gas lighting became popular, as it was a more reliable and brighter source of light compared to oil lamps. The first electric street lights were installed in the United States in the late 19th century, marking the beginning of a new era in urban lighting.

Types of Street Lights There are several types of street lights available, each with its own advantages and applications: - High-Pressure Sodium (HPS) Lights: These are the most common type of street lights, known for their high efficiency and long lifespan. HPS lights emit a warm, yellowish light that is ideal for street and road illumination. - LED Street Lights: LED technology has revolutionized the street lighting industry. LED lights are highly energy-efficient, durable, and have a longer lifespan than traditional bulbs. They also offer better color rendering and can be dimmed or adjusted to suit different lighting needs. - Fluorescent Street Lights: Fluorescent lights are another popular choice for street lighting. They are energy-efficient and provide a bright, white light that is suitable for areas with higher pedestrian traffic. - Halogen Street Lights: Halogen lights are known for their bright, white light and are often used in areas where high visibility is required.

Benefits of Street Lights Street lights offer numerous benefits to both the public and the authorities responsible for maintaining urban infrastructure: - Enhanced Safety: By providing illumination, street lights reduce the risk of accidents and crimes. They make it easier for pedestrians and drivers to navigate the streets safely. - Energy Efficiency: Modern street lights, especially LED and HPS lights, consume less energy than traditional bulbs, resulting in lower utility bills and reduced carbon emissions. - Longevity: The lifespan of modern street lights is significantly longer than that of traditional bulbs, reducing maintenance costs and the need for frequent replacements. - Aesthetics: Well-designed street lights can enhance the aesthetic appeal of a city or town, contributing to its overall ambiance.

Smart Street Lights The integration of technology into street lighting has led to the development of smart street lights. These lights are equipped with sensors and communication capabilities, allowing them to adjust their brightness and functionality based on environmental conditions and usage patterns. Some of the features of smart street lights include: - Energy Management: Smart street lights can dim or turn off when not needed, saving energy and reducing costs. - Public Safety: Sensors can detect unusual activities or emergencies, alerting authorities immediately. - Environmental Monitoring: Smart street lights can be used to monitor environmental conditions such as air quality and noise levels.

Future Trends in Street Lighting The future of street lighting is expected to be shaped by several trends: - Further Energy Efficiency: As technology advances, street lights will continue to become more energy-efficient, further reducing their environmental impact. - Integration with Smart Cities: Street lights will play a crucial role in the development of smart cities, with their capabilities expanding to include data collection and management. - Customization: The ability to customize the lighting based on specific needs, such as adjusting brightness for different times of the day or events, will become more prevalent. - Renewable Energy: The integration of renewable energy sources, such as solar power, will make street lights even more sustainable. In conclusion, street lights have come a long way since their inception. From simple gas lamps to advanced smart systems, they have become an essential part of urban life. As technology continues to evolve, street lights will play an increasingly important role in enhancing safety, efficiency, and sustainability in our cities.
